In the year 2022 some of the richest men in Ecuador paid less Income Tax (IR) compared to several previous periods. But there are things that are more surprising: Isabel Noboa Pontón pays, for example, 10 times less than Ángelo Caputi Oyague, who manages, but does not own, Banco Guayaquil.
She is the main shareholder of Nobis Holding. It generates 5,000 jobs, has five business units (agribusiness, real estate, exports, shopping centers, and mass consumption), 60 active projects, and the year that ended it paid just $31,357 in Income Tax (IR). Ángelo Caputi, executive president of the Guayaquil bank, $210,562.
The businesswoman also pays less than the Vanoni shrimpers, than the Wong bananas. She pays less than her brother Álvaro and others who have less wealth than the owner of the Valdez mill, Mall del Sol, Pronobis.
Characters such as Euclides, Franklin and Darwin Palacios and Marianela Ubilla appear in the top 5 of banana exports, but their IR seems little for the volume of business they handle. Palacios and his sons are owners of Corporación Palmar (banana exporter, producer of plastic bags, spray fumigation). Ubilla owns Agzulasa
The President of the Republic, Guillermo Lasso Mendoza, according to SRI records, dropped from more than $900,000 paid in IR in 2021 to only $4,992 in 2022.
Businessmen | 2022 | 2021 |
Fidel Egas | does not present | 5,252,309.33 |
Alvaro Noboa Ponton | 1,376,476.22 | 1,220,482.54 |
Johny Czarninski Bair | does not present | 770,779.44 |
William Lasso | 4,992.49 | 900,923.42 |
Luis Bakker Guerra | No presenta | 722,965.84 |
Carlos Cueva González | 443,603.45 | 166,456.61 |
Vicente Wong Naranjo | 158,759.79 | 151,963.49 |
Rafael Wong Naranjo | 158,759.79 | 151,448.68 |
Roberto Aguirre Román | 132,808.41 | 169,468.25 |
Owen Durán Ballén | 77,237.68 | 245,807.41 |
Leonardo Vanoni Darquea | 95,275.78 | 41,018.13 |
Sandro Coglitore Castillo | 95,275.79 | 40,789.43 |
Francisco Xavier Vanoni Darquea | 87,313.92 | 37,113.41 |
Aldo José Vanoni Darquea | 85,232.51 | 37,092.73 |
Carlos Vanoni Darquea | 79,576.50 | 13,717.93 |
Juan Pablo Eljuri Vintimilla | 33,672.00 | 42,434.23 |
Isabel Noboa Pontón | 31,357.29 | 21,176.99 |
María Vanoni Darquea | 20,030.15 | 5,214.67 |
Euclides Palacios Placios | 1,858.28 | 82,799.05 |
Roque Sevilla Llarrea | No presenta | 80,861.24 |
Sandra Monroy Moreno | No presenta | 80,731.82 |
Darwin Palacios Márquez | 1,397.98 | 38,763.25 |
Franklin Palacios Márquez | 26,042.36 | 45,243.82 |
Marianela Ubilla Mendoza | 7,432.60 | 13,602.40 |
Santiago Salem Barakat | No presenta | 14,910.88 |
Juan Carlos Crespo Moreno | 8,659.97 | 36,882.25 |
Michel Deller Klein | 32,577.32 | 1,454,908.07 |
Angelo Caputi | 210,562.71 | 140,697.48 |

The SRI reported that Guillermo Lasso Mendoza paid $4,992 in 2022. Nothing, compared to Álvaro Noboa’s IR: $1,376,476.22. Or the 443,603.45 of Carlos Cueva González, from Difare. Or the $132,808.41 from Roberto Aguirre Román, from Negocios Industriales Real, who also owns a large tuna fleet.
